We've chosen a welcoming, comfortable venue that's well suited to parents and babies. There is free parking on site, baby changing facilities available, and the venue is buggy and pram friendly. Full venue details, directions and parking information will be sent to you before the course begins.

Yes. Tea, coffee and light refreshments will be available at each session. There's also a lovely café/restaurant on site, making it the perfect place to grab a coffee, enjoy some food, or continue chatting with other parents after the session if you'd like to.

Our groups are designed for the person who is pregnant or navigating early parenthood. Some sessions or special events may include partners, and we'll always make it clear when that's the case.

Each session includes a relaxed mix of conversation, practical information, connection and support. There may be a topic or activity to explore, and on certain weeks we will have local professionals attending to provide you with some tips. There's no pressure and plenty of time for chatting, asking questions and getting to know other parents.

Not at all. Some people love sharing, while others prefer to listen and take things in. Both are absolutely fine. You're welcome to join in as much or as little as feels comfortable.

Parenthood can bring up all sorts of emotions, and you don't need to hide that here. Our groups are run by experienced doulas who understand the ups and downs that can come with this stage of life. We'll do our best to create a supportive, non-judgemental space where you can simply be yourself. If you need a moment, that's okay too.

Absolutely. Many people come along without knowing anyone else. One of the lovely things about the group is meeting other local parents who are navigating a similar stage of life.

That's completely expected. Babies are welcome to be babies here. Feel free to feed, cuddle, change, rock or settle your little one whenever they need you. There's no need to apologise or step out unless you'd prefer to.
